Myo is a gesture control armband developed by Thalmic Labs. The device consist of a band of 8 EMG muscle sensors and IMUs. When worn on a user's forearm, Myo detects the user's hand gestures and arm motion.

Hardware

Specifications

Part Spec
Size Expendable between 7.5 - 13 inches (19 - 34 cm)
Weight 93g
Sensors Medical Grade Stainless Steel EMG sensors, Gyroscope, Accelerometer, Magnetometer
Processor ARM Cortex M4 Processor
LEDs Dual Indicator LEDs
Connectivity Bluetooth LE
Power micro-USB for charging, rechargeable lithium ion battery
